A New Privacy Problem Could Deepen Facebook's Legal Trouble

On Sunday, the New York Times revealed that Facebook had deals with phone manufacturers including Apple, Amazon, Microsoft, and Blackberry going back a decade that gave the device makers access to copious amounts of personal data about users and their friends in order to recreate a mobile version of Facebook on their devices.
